A fault diagnosis method of power converter of switched reluctance motor

摘要: 针对现有开关磁阻电动机功率变换器故障诊断方法存在可靠性不高等问题,提出了一种新型的功率管故障诊断方法。该方法以不对称半桥型功率变换器主电路为研究对象,以常见的功率管开路和短路2种故障情况为诊断对象,通过比较母线电流估算值和实测值来判断故障,结合故障相绕组电流实现故障相的识别,必要时通过中断测试来确定故障点。选取电动机空载、低速度和高速度运行等较难实现故障诊断的工况进行了试验分析,结果表明,该方法均能完成故障类型的定性及故障点的准确定位。

Abstract: For low reliability of existing fault diagnosis method of power converter of switched reluctance motor, the paper proposed a new type of fault diagnosis method of power tube. The new method takes main circuit of asymmetric half-bridge power converter as study object, and two kinds of common faults of open circuit and short circuit of power tube as diagnosis objects. It determines fault by comparing estimate value and actual value of bus current, achieves identification of fault phase combining with winding current of fault phase, and determines fault point by interrupting test if necessary. The paper selects conditions which are difficult to achieve fault diagnosis of motor operation with no-load, low-speed and high-speed for experiment and analysis, and the results indicate that the proposed method can complete accurate determination of fault type and location of fault point.
